Q. Will a vehicle wrap damage my vehicle’s paint upon removal?
A. No. In all of our experiences, the only time a vehicle’s paint may be affected is in the case of a poor repaint job. Factory paint, in 99.0% of instances, is not affect by our wraps.

Q. How long will a wrap last on my vehicle?
A. Our wraps will normally outlast the vehicle. You can expect your wrap to last 5 years or longer, providing you are careful about power washing.

Q. How do I care for my wrap?
A. Hand washing is best. Avoid high pressure washes and be careful never to use an ice-scraper. Sweeping off windows with a soft broom and rear defroster will cause no damage to your window wrap.
Q. What’s the difference between a ½, ¾, and full wrap?
A. 1/2 Wrap includes the entire rear of the vehicle and 1/2 way up the vehicle, and includes a hood logo.
3/4 Wrap includes the entire rear of the vehicle and 3/4 way up the vehicle, and includes a hood logo.
Typically, a Full Wrap includes the entire surface of the vehicle with or without the roof, depending on the vehicle and the client’s wishes.

Q. What kind of resolution is required for artwork files, and which type of files do you accept?
A. For vehicles, it is important to finish with a resolution of no less than 75dpi at full size. We can accept almost any file type
(PC or Mac) and prefer the format to be in line-art, such as .eps files.

Q. Can you wrap anything other than a vehicle?
A. Yes. We have wrapped buildings, windows, storefronts and machinery. Providing that the surface to wrap has enough adhesion for the vinyl, a wrap is possible.
